Quadratic trinomals are in the form of x^2+bx+c
You need to find the factors of c that add up to b.
So the first question x^2+5x-14
You are looking for the factors (multiply) of -14 that add up to 5
You need to do the same for the next one. Factors of 3 that add up to -4
Those factors would be -3 and -1
That makes the factors (x-1)(x-3)

12.
6a(a + 3) = 2a(3a + 5) + 16
First, distribute 6a on the left side, and distribute 2a on the right side.
6a² + 18a = 6a² + 10a + 16
Subtract 6a² from both sides.
18a = 10a + 16
Subtract 10a from both sides.
8a = 16
Divide both sides by 8.
a = 2
